It's a bit counter-intuitive but the market assumes you always want to buy from the cheapest seller.<br /><br />So if<br />random sells EMP S at 40 isk<br />Your alt sells EMP S at 10 million isk<br /><br />when you click on your alt's order you buy one EMP S for 10 million but the money goes to the random player, not your alt.Stabshttps://www.blogger.com/profile/08716211705647213383noreply@blogger.comtag:blogger.com,1999:blog-36733892.post-83487863549711672442012-03-08T20:50:46.337+00:002012-03-08T20:50:46.337+00:00Forgive me if I missed this in your story :) but d...Forgive me if I missed this in your story :) but did you check for existing orders? I think the explanation may be that there was already someone selling that type of rusty bullet in your station and your ISK went to them.<br /><br />(The sell order with the lowest asking price always fills first and it fills at the price specified by the buyer even if the buyer was offering an amount several orders of magnitude higher.)<br /><br />Does that sound possible?Yazelhttps://www.blogger.com/profile/03944032584703502265noreply@blogger.comtag:blogger.com,1999:blog-36733892.post-12506237717518631192012-03-08T17:56:29.412+00:002012-03-08T17:56:29.412+00:00Will check out Tiger Ears Arden D, thank for link....Will check out Tiger Ears Arden D, thank for link.
